With its crystal-clear waters, rolling hills, and picturesque vineyards, it’s no wonder why so ma...Sep 19, 2022 · Cheese rolling involves sending a wheel of cheese rolling down Gloucestershire’s dizzyingly steep Cooper’s Hill. Then contestants run after it. Catching the cheese, a 7-pound Double Gloucester, mid-chase is a non-starter. It’s been clocked at upwards of 70 miles per hour. The laws of physics are against you.

For the Cheese Rolling and Wake, participants race down Cooper’s Hill, which is a 200-yard-long hill, following the rolling down of a round of Double Gloucester cheese. Aug 8, 2015 · The Cooper's Hill Cheese Rolling competition typically has five downhill races — four for men, and one for women. Sometimes a safer uphill race is organized for the children. Each race is taken part by 20-40 participants. Traditionally, this game was played by the local villagers, but now people from all over the world take part.
